Derrick Lewis has given fans incredible highlights over the years, and yet his 2017 knockout over Travis Browne still remains one of his best wins.
“The Black Beast” brutally defeated Browne in the second round of the UFC Fight Night 105 heavyweight main event. That stoppage came after vicious kicks from Brown left Lewis in trouble several times in the fight. Although the fight lasted less than two rounds, it was a wild fight that won Fight of the Night honors.
